The article highlights the growing trend among homeowners to remodel their bathrooms, with findings indicating that 93% plan upgrades by 2025. A notable preference has emerged for showers, particularly spacious, groutless ones that provide a modern look and luxury feel. Angi cofounder Angie Hicks distinguishes between upgrades, which are cosmetic adjustments, and remodels, involving layout changes and substantial renovations. As today's homeowners prioritize both aesthetics and functionality, the shift toward shower installations reflects current bathroom design trends and lifestyle preferences.
